Add basic automated script

Florian Müllner requested to merge fmuellner/gnome-shell:more-scripting into master

Quoting the last commit:

While the performance framework was originally written to collect
performance metrics, driving the shell by an automated script is
also useful to ensure that basic functionality is working.

Add such a basic test, initially checking top bar menus, notifications
and the overview.

The idea is to combine this with !1349 (merged) to have a more elaborate (and easier to extend) test case than opening the overview view the D-Bus Eval() method.

